Tuesday, September 25, 2012

chelle on Scotland Tonight

In case you wanted to check and see if I made a total fool of myself on Scottish National TV - here's a link to the interview :)

By the way - have I mentioned anyone how painful it is for me to watch myself on video?!?!

In case you missed it be sure to also check out the link to the 29 Studios Event video!!

1 comment:

  1. I thought you were excellent. I had no idea what you did besides SFactor. I think its awesome that you're promoting to kids about space and science. These subjects are very important for our future and are really cool.